FIX - but no guarantees -
Good Morning Everyone!
I posted this before, but I guess nobody really tried what I posted, but flushing the DNS like everyone is talking about is not going to work utill your ISP does so.
You're going to have to use another DNS like Google Public DNS to get to the d-addicts site for the time being.
Every OS is different, but generally for Windows...
1. get into properties for your Local Area Connection
2. Select Internet Protocol(TCP/IP) and click Properties
3. select the 'Use the following DNS server addresses:' radio button.
4. fill in [8.8.8.8] for the 'Preferred DNS server:' and
5. fill in [8.8.4.4] for the 'Alternate DNS server:' then press OK.
6. Then OK one more time. it should work after that.
